About Foreclosure Law in 's-Hertogenbosch, Netherlands

Foreclosure in 's-Hertogenbosch, Netherlands, refers to the legal process through which a lender can take possession of a property when the borrower fails to make mortgage payments. It is essential to understand the laws and regulations governing foreclosure in order to protect your rights as a homeowner or borrower.
